Richard Sherrod, Age 60

Memphis, TN
Search Report

Known As:

Richard Norfleet, Richard S Herrod, Richard Sherrard, Richard S Harrod, Rick Sherrod, Richard Sharrod

Phone Numbers
(901) 354-3214
Used to Live in
2220 Durham Ave, Memphis, TN 38127
UNLOCK REPORT

Phones and Addresses

FAQ about Richard Sherrod

  • What is Richard Sherrod’s phone number?

    Richard Sherrod’s phone number is (901) 354-3214.

  • What is Richard Sherrod’s date of birth?

    Richard Sherrod was born on 1964.